Guilt-Free Crispy Avocado Wedges with Honey Sriracha Mayo
Yield: 4 servings
2 large, ripe avocados, but not mushy
1 1/2 cups panko breadcrumbs
1 teaspoon garlic powder
1 teaspoon onion powder
1 teaspoon smoked paprika
1/2 teaspoon kosher salt
1/4 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
2 large eggs
Honey Sriracha Mayo (see recipe)
Preheat your air fryer to 390°F. Cut the avocados in half, remove the pit, and slice each half into wedges. In a small bowl, whisk the eggs. In another bowl, mix the panko breadcrumbs with garlic powder, onion powder, paprika, salt, and pepper. Dip each wedge first in the egg mixture, then coat generously with the breadcrumb mixture. Repeat with the remaining wedges. Place the avocado in a single layer in the air fryer basket. (You may need to work in batches depending on the size of your air fryer.) Cook for about 8 minutes or until the wedges are golden and crispy. Cool for 1 to 2 minutes before serving. Enjoy warm with Honey Sriracha Mayo.
Chef Stacy Tip: If you do not have an air fryer or wish to deep fry your avocados, add 1/2 cup of all-purpose flour to your recipe. Dip each avocado wedge first in the flour, then the egg mixture, and lastly the breadcrumb mixture. Repeat with the remaining wedges. In a large cast-iron skillet, add enough vegetable oil (or avocado, peanut, or canola oil) to coat the bottom by 1-inch. Heat over medium-high heat until a fry thermometer reaches 350°F. Add the avocado wedges but do not overcrowd the pan. Cook in the hot oil for 1 to 2 minutes, just until the crust sets. Gently flip over and cook for another 1 to 2 minutes. Remove with a slotted spoon or spider and place on a clean wire rack over a rimmed sheet tray . Repeat with the remaining wedges.
Honey Sriracha Mayo
Yield: about 1/2 cup
1/3 cup favorite mayonnaise
1 to 2tablespoons Sriracha sauce
2 teaspoons honey
1 1/2 teaspoon lemon juice or lime juice
1 clove garlic pressed or minced
1/2 teaspoon grated fresh ginger
Kosher salt and freshly ground pepper, to taste
Add the mayonnaise, sriracha sauce, lemon juice, honey, ginger, and garlic to a medium-sized bowl. Whisk to combine until all of the ingredients are well blended. Taste and add salt and pepper as needed. Store in an air tight container in the refrigerator untilready to use.
